Output 44170899869acd516658be0638ada22585fcaa982418b2bc3a4b289fa65d2528:0

value
864709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 179c1c1df67139fab8ad0ba31a9ba47c41bd2cf6 OP_EQUAL
address
33qrUf4uTa6oZWdNU8nx3PXU3XtPRuhFiN
transaction
44170899869acd516658be0638ada22585fcaa982418b2bc3a4b289fa65d2528